Construction union UCATT is currently preparing for the election of its General Secretary. During the process, prospective candidates for election were required to attend the union's Selection Committee, in accordance with the union’s rulebook, on 26th October 2011.
Following that meeting the Selection Committee has decided that Michael Dooley and Alan Ritchie do not fulfil the criteria as suitable candidates for the position of General Secretary. The decision was taken on the basis of the interview on 26th October.
Michael Dooley and Alan Ritchie have been informed of the Selection Committee's decision and their names have been removed from the ballot paper. The Selection Committee's decision has been ratified by the Executive Council.
The remaining two candidates Steve Murphy and Jerry Swain, will go forward to the full ballot. Ballot papers will be distributed to the union’s membership entitled to vote, on 11th November 2011.
